The Undeniable Need for PDF Watermarking in a Digital World
In today's fast-paced digital landscape, the security and authenticity of documents are paramount. Whether you're sharing sensitive reports, distributing copyrighted material, or simply branding your official paperwork, adding a watermark to your PDF files is a simple yet incredibly effective way to achieve these goals. Watermarking acts as a visible layer of protection, deterring unauthorized use and clearly identifying the origin or status of a document. But how can you implement this crucial feature seamlessly into your applications or workflows without reinventing the wheel? Enter TompisAPIs's powerful PDF Watermark API.
Introducing TompisAPIs's Advanced PDF Watermark API
TompisAPIs offers a robust and versatile PDF Watermark API designed to give developers, SaaS owners, and entrepreneurs unparalleled control over their document security and branding. This API empowers you to effortlessly embed either custom text or an image logo directly onto your PDF files. Forget about clunky desktop software or manual processes; with a simple POST request, you can transform your ordinary PDFs into professionally protected documents.
The API provides two primary endpoints:
/api/pdf-toolkit/pdf-watermark/
: For watermarking individual PDF files./api/pdf-toolkit/pdf-watermark/batch/
: For efficiently processing multiple PDFs simultaneously, a game-changer for high-volume operations.
Its flexibility ensures that whether you need to add a "CONFIDENTIAL" stamp or a company logo, the process is streamlined and highly customizable.
Unrivaled Control: Features That Set Our API Apart
What truly distinguishes the TompisAPIs PDF Watermark API is its extensive range of parameters, allowing for granular control over every aspect of your watermark's appearance and placement:
- Text or Image Watermarks: Choose between a simple
watermark_text
like a draft status or an uploadedlogo_file
(supporting PNG, JPG, GIF, SVG) for branding. You must provide at least one. - Precise Positioning: Place your watermark exactly where it needs to be with predefined
position
options (center
,top-left
,top-right
,bottom-left
,bottom-right
) or usex_offset
andy_offset
for custom pixel-perfect placement. - Dynamic Appearance: Adjust
rotation
from -360 to 360 degrees, control thescale
(0.1 to 5.0) of your watermark, and set theopacity
(0 to 1) for subtle or prominent effects. For text, customizefont_family
(Helvetica, Arial, Times, Courier),font_size
,font_weight
(normal, bold), andtext_color
(hex codes). For logos, specifylogo_size
in pixels while maintaining aspect ratio. - Intelligent Page Selection: Apply watermarks to
all
pages (default), onlyodd
oreven
pages, thefirst
orlast
page, or provide a comma/space-separated list of specificpages
(e.g., "1,3-5"). You can alsoskip_first_page
orskip_last_page
if needed. - Repeat Patterns: For maximum impact and protection, enable
repeat_pattern
and definerepeat_spacing_x
andrepeat_spacing_y
to tile your watermark across the entire page.
This comprehensive set of features ensures that your watermarks are not just present, but perfectly integrated and aesthetically pleasing.
Seamless Integration and Flexible Output Options
Integrating the PDF Watermark API into your existing applications is straightforward. The API accepts your PDF file via a POST request and offers multiple ways to receive the watermarked output, adapting to your specific needs:
- Direct PDF Download: The default
response_type
ofpdf
returns the watermarked document directly for immediate download. - Base64 Encoded JSON: For web applications or scenarios requiring programmatic handling, set
response_type
tobase64
to receive the PDF as a base64 string within a JSON object, complete with metadata like file size and processing time. - ZIP Archive: Opt for
response_type: zip
to get a ZIP file containing the watermarked PDF, the original PDF, your logo (if provided), and a metadata JSON file, perfect for archival or detailed auditing.
The /batch/
endpoint extends this flexibility, allowing you to upload multiple PDFs and receive a single ZIP archive containing all the watermarked documents and a summary JSON, making bulk processing incredibly efficient.
"The TompisAPIs PDF Watermark API transformed our document workflow. The level of customization for watermarks, combined with the batch processing capability, saved us countless hours."
Powerful Use Cases Across Industries
The applications for robust PDF watermarking are diverse and impactful:
- SaaS Platforms: Offer a premium feature to users allowing them to watermark their uploaded documents for enhanced security or branding.
- Legal & Financial Firms: Mark sensitive documents as "Draft," "Confidential," or "For Internal Use Only" before distribution.
- Educational Institutions: Protect intellectual property in course materials or research papers.
- E-commerce & Licensing: Add unique watermarks to digital products (eBooks, templates) to deter unauthorized sharing.
- Real Estate: Brand property listings or contracts with agency logos without altering original content.
- Government & Compliance: Timestamp or classify official records to meet regulatory requirements.
By automating the watermarking process, businesses can maintain document integrity, enhance brand visibility, and streamline their operational efficiency.
Get Started with Secure PDF Watermarking Today!
Protecting your digital assets has never been easier or more powerful. The TompisAPIs PDF Watermark API provides a comprehensive, flexible, and scalable solution for all your document watermarking needs. Integrate this essential tool into your applications and take control of your PDF security and branding. Explore the API, test its features, and experience the seamless document protection it offers.
Ready to secure your PDFs? Visit the TompisAPIs PDF Watermark API on RapidAPI to learn more and subscribe!